Title: Scheduled report exports shift timestamps by one hour after DST change

Description: Since Sunday, Fernlight customers in regions observing daylight saving see all exported CSV timestamps offset by one hour. Dashboards render correctly; only the export path is affected. The exporter appears to apply the UTC offset captured at schedule creation rather than at run time. Workaround: re-create the schedule. Priority high — billing reports are due Friday. The regression was introduced in the build referenced below.

pipeline stamp: htk31_f769b577b3028a4e9958e5bb8d1259a

Quick intro for the eng sync: the Copperleaf points ledger is append-only — every earn, burn, and adjustment is a row, and balances are just a rollup view refreshed every minute. Don't ever mutate ledger rows; if something's wrong, write a compensating entry. Most of you will only touch it through the Tallyhouse API, which handles idempotency keys for you. To poke at the staging ledger yourself, you'll authenticate as the shared eng service account, whose key is included below.

service key, bajep-hahig: zpat15_8GdlyV2kd9BCqYH

### VELLUM-884: Connection failures from the formula sandbox workers

The sandbox pool that evaluates user-supplied formulas is exhausting its database connections during peak evaluation windows. Each sandboxed worker opens its own connection rather than borrowing from the shared pool, and leaked handles accumulate until the limiter trips. Before restarting the workers, capture the current connection count and the oldest idle sessions for the postmortem. To inspect active sessions on the sandbox metadata store, connect using the string below.

primary connection of yagep-kahip = redis://giliel_svc:zYiKsLL2PLpfPL@db-348f.xolmarsys.corp:5432/fenwyn

Runbook: Plover diff viewer, large-file path. When a diff request exceeds the streaming threshold, Plover shards the comparison across the chunker pool rather than loading both files into memory. If maintainers see timeouts on files above a few hundred megabytes, first confirm the chunker pool is healthy, then check that shard sizes were not changed ad hoc. The service expects the following configuration values.

settings of fafog-haduf:
ZORIX_PIN=4648
ZORIX_METRICS_HOST=metrics.zorix.paliqsys.corp
ZORIX_LOG_LEVEL=info
ZORIX_TENANT=druix